The US Air Power series is the definitive illustrated guide to recent American dominance in the skies. Covering the planes and crews of the USAF as well as Naval, Marine and Army air wings, these books cover a period from World War II through to the present day in which American pilots have prevailed in all combat situations and have laid the foundation for the swift and decisive victories achieved during that time. The 72 pages include well over 100 photographs, 16 pages of which are in color, and every photo has a detailed caption outlining combat histories and technical specification. The series will cover all the major conflicts in which the US has been involved recently including both Gulf Wars, the Balkans and Afghanistan. Modern Air Superiority Planes features the cutting edge of America's aircraft and weaponry that contribute to its massive combat might. The book includes some of the most famous names in operation today: the F-14 Tomcat and the F-15 Eagle amongst others as well as a selection of the massive air-to-air armory available to them such as the Sidewinder and the AMRAAM.
